The Good Messenger Book

The Good Messenger is an epic tale of love, loyalty and deception set across three decades. 1912: Tom Shepherd reluctantly stays for two weeks at Hardinge Hall. Mr and Mrs Hardinge are trying to arrange a marriage for their son Teddy to Iris, daughter of a local businessman. Tommy becomes the innocent messenger who delivers the secret arrangements. Armistice Day 1918: The First World War has changed everything, especially the closeted world that Iris, Teddy and Tom existed in. 1927. Tom is now a journalist investigating the discovery of a baby's bones in the woods around Hardinge Hall. Past and present move towards a resolution that might still bring everything crashing down.Read More
